I get a lot of questions about specifications. It has a CAT 3116 which is a 6.6L that is 175 HP and 538 FT LBS torque with governor, that if the pedal is held steady, the speed is steady. It is governed to 68 MPH at 2800 RPM by spec and floats to 71 MPH. It has a 5 speed Fuller-Eaton (No OD). Truck is not air ride, nor air float cab or seats. I get asked a lot of questions about mileage. 13 empty, 10 loaded with max on trailer, and better than 8 floored loaded.
